Electronic devices are getting smaller, performance is increasing, and the demands on PCB design and manufacturing are growing. ??? Miniaturization of PCBs is not just about shrinking board sizes – it involves finer trace widths, smaller vias, and advanced laminates. This requires new approaches from designers and manufacturers, who must adapt to technologies like microvias or pattern plating.


?? Key Facts About PCB Miniaturization:

? Finer copper layers and microvias enable compact designs.

? Technologies like buried/blind vias improve routing options.

? Applications span industries: wearables, automation, RF tech, and more.
